Present experiment comprised of macronutrient treatments consisted of five levels of nitrogen (0, 30, 60, 90 and 120 Kg N ha−1), four levels of phosphorus (0, 30, 60 and 90 Kg P2O5 ha−1) and four levels of potassium (0, 30, 60 and 90 Kg K2O ha−1). Increasing levels of NPK increased growth parameters like plant height, leaf area index. Yield components also increased with increasing levels of NPK. Maximum seed yield (2006 Kg ha−1) was recorded with NPK @ 120:90:90 Kg ha−1 (T7). Cu, Fe and Mn uptake was observed maximum in T7 but Zn uptake was observed higher with NPK @ 120:60:60 Kg ha−1 (T6).
